TV3 is a Ghanaian free-to-air television network in Ghana. [1] Launched in 1997 by Malaysian company Sistem Televisyen Malaysia Berhad, [2] TV3 airs and produces a variety of television programmes including news bulletins, dramas and reality television and entertainment shows. GTV broadcasts mainly local programming, with over 80% of the schedule consisting of original productions. Although its main production studio is located in Accra, capital city of Ghana, it has affiliations nationwide and covers 98% of the airwaves in Ghana, making it the most powerful mode of advertisement in Ghana. The Business and Financial Times (B&FT) is a Ghanaian privately owned newspaper which focuses on reporting business news from Ghana and across the African continent.
